How to Make Classic Italian Ricotta Breakfast Sweets

Classic Italian ricotta breakfast sweets are a delightful way to start your day. These treats are not only delicious but also simple to prepare. With a creamy ricotta base, they offer a perfect balance of flavor and texture. In this article, we will explore how to make these sweet treats that can brighten up any breakfast table.

Ingredients You'll Need

To make classic Italian ricotta breakfast sweets, gather the following ingredients:

  • 1 cup fresh ricotta cheese
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1/2 cup sugar
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• Powdered sugar (for dusting)
  • Fresh fruits (optional, for serving)

Step-by-Step Instructions

Step 1: Prepare the Ricotta Mixture

In a large mixing bowl, combine the fresh ricotta cheese, eggs, sugar, and vanilla extract. Use a whisk to blend these ingredients until smooth and creamy. Make sure there are no lumps in the mixture.

Step 2: Combine Dry Ingredients

In a separate bowl, whisk together the all-purpose flour, baking powder, and salt. This will ensure that the dry ingredients are evenly distributed.

Step 3: Mix Wet and Dry Ingredients

Gradually add the dry ingredients to the ricotta mixture. Stir gently with a spatula or wooden spoon until just combined. Be careful not to overmix; a few lumps are perfectly fine.

Step 4: Preheat Your Cooking Surface

Heat a non-stick skillet or frying pan over medium heat. You can brush a little butter or oil onto the surface to prevent sticking.

Step 5: Cook the Ricotta Breakfast Sweets

Using a ladle or measuring cup, pour a small amount of the batter onto the heated skillet. Cook for about 2-3 minutes on one side until bubbles form on the surface, then flip and cook for another 2 minutes until golden brown. Repeat the process with the remaining batter.

Step 6: Serve and Enjoy

Once cooked, transfer the ricotta breakfast sweets to a serving plate. Dust them with powdered sugar and serve with fresh fruits like berries or sliced bananas for a pop of color and flavor.

Tips for Perfect Ricotta Breakfast Sweets

To elevate your classic Italian ricotta breakfast sweets, consider the following tips:

  • Use high-quality ricotta for the best flavor and texture.
  • Experiment by adding lemon zest or almond extract for a unique twist.
  • Serve with maple syrup or honey for extra sweetness.
  • Consider adding nuts or chocolate chips to the batter for added crunch and flavor.
